Why it was recalled
According to the FDA_DEVICE notice, the identified hazard is: Product is missing the label on the internal packaging.
This Class III recall concerns device products distributed in United States and was recorded by FDA_DEVICE. Recalls in this category are published so that owners, retailers, and importers can identify affected units and act quickly.
